Output 72666da955b50a8d177a666e45ad327d3032ad84d990a5bb8fe9bf9c05c64b04:3

value
969615048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35fa90b6fb053408869f89264fed7f2805e44d1d OP_EQUAL
address
36cRuHv7rtmPGyRpRRKjcvB1dFqvvn62Mt
transaction
72666da955b50a8d177a666e45ad327d3032ad84d990a5bb8fe9bf9c05c64b04
spent
true